World IN BRIEF / NETHERLANDS : Tudjman Not in U.N. Indictment
Croatian President Franjo Tudjman is not the subject of a sealed U.N. indictment for war crimes, the international criminal tribunal in the Hague said. Prosecution spokesman Paul Risley was confirming comments attributed to deputy prosecutor Graham Blewitt by a Croatian newspaper earlier this week. “The deputy prosecutor told a Croatian reporter that Mr. Tudjman is not under a sealed indictment presently,” Risley said. Speculation had been rife in Croatia that U.N. prosecutors had set their sights on Tudjman for his alleged role in the fighting that accompanied the breakup of the former Yugoslav federation.
